Description: Pilgrims is a travel planning and journaling app that allows users to document details and memories from their trips. It includes features to map out itineraries, budget expenses, upload photos and videos, and write journal entries for each day of the journey.

Description: Thimbleweed Park is a point-and-click adventure game developed by Ron Gilbert and Gary Winnick. It features retro pixel-art, complex puzzles, and a twisted, comedic storyline.
